Fiona Collins grew up in an Essex village & after stints in Hong Kong and London returned to the Essex countryside where she lives with her husband & three children. She has a degree in Film & Literature & has had many former careers including TV presenting in Hong Kong, traffic & weather presenter for BBC local radio & film/TV extra. Fiona writes contemporary women's fiction.

I was luckier than my main character, Arden, and did make it onto a Film Studies course at university in the late 80s, where I had the pleasure of studying most of the films on Mac and Arden’s List. The premise for the book sprang from a moment of nostalgia I had about my time on this course, how some of the movies I studied had made me feel, how much I had changed as a person since those days… and I came up with the story of Mac and Arden, which, in both the past and the present, would revolve around a list of classic films.

I like the idea of a book being punctuated or tabulated in some way by another medium – songs, or movies – and found hinging Mac and Arden’s love story on the movies they’d seen (plus using a structure of alternate ‘past’ and ‘present’ chapters, in the main) made this book a joy to write. Research was also a joy: I thoroughly enjoyed watching the movies on The List – some I have seen dozens of times over the years, others I had not watched for a long, long time - reading film theory, and immersing myself in the world of Film. I hope that readers will delight in re-acquainting themselves with some of these old movies, or if they don’t know them, seek them out and watch them for the first time - lucky them!

With Arden, I wanted to write a character who has changed massively as a person since her student days, due to the life that has been thrown hard at her. I also wanted to write a female protagonist in her late 40s to show that older women have the same yearnings and potential for awakenings as a woman of any age. I wanted a character with life experience and wisdom, but someone who still has a lot to learn and to feel. By reflecting on her past strength and her love story with Mac, Arden is finally able to imagine a future for herself.

I am totally in love with Mac and Arden, and their story. I really wanted to write from the heart and I hope readers will feel that’s exactly where this book is from.
